Phrasal verbs


Match the two columns. Potriviţi cele două coloane:
I. to look
1.look after                                           a. to find a word in the dictionary
2. look for                                             b. to read(often quickly)
3. look forward to                                 c. to take care of
4. look into                                            d. to search for
5. look through                                      e. to expect, to anticipate
6. look up                                              f. to find out about something, to investigate
II. to turn
1.      turn back                                          a. to change and become something else
2.      turn down                                         b. to prove to be something, to appear, be present
3.      turn into                                            c. to arrive somewhere, to increase
4.      turn off                                             d. to stop and return the way you came
5.      turn on                                              e. to refuse something
6.      turn out                                             f. to start
7.      turn up                                              g. to stop
III. to set
1.      set about                                            a. to build/erect something, to start/arrange something
2.      set aside                                             b. to delay
3.      set back                                              c. to begin to do
4.      set off/out                                           d. to save for a special purpose
5.      set up                                                  e. to start a journey
IV. to give
1. give away                                             a. to reveal something, to give something for free
2. give in                                                   b. to stop doing something
3. give off                                                 c. to surrender
4. give out                                                 d. to hand out, to stop working
5. give up                                                  e.  to produce/smell, heat, sound, etc.)
V. to carry
1. carry off                                                a. to be very excited
2. carry on                                                 b. to act according to instructions, or orders
3. carry out                                                c. to complete something successfully
4. carry over                                              d. to handle a difficult situation
5. carry through                                         e. to let something continue into a new situation
6. be/get carried away                               f. to continue doing something
